Top of 1st gear...

Does anyone else notice a bit of a lull between 4,000 and 6,000 RPM? Not like the engine revolutions aren't rapidly climbing, because they are, but the car's acceleration seems to lull in 1st in this range. Then comes 2nd and anywhere between 3,000 and 6,000 accelerates rapidly as you would expect.

So I'm wondering, would it be faster in say a 1/4 mile run to shift to second between 4,000 and 5,000 leaving more room for 2nd gear to pull?

Obviously never done a timed run in the SS, just curious if others have noticed this.

The "acceleration" or pulling you describe would be torque. I noticed that torque on the LS3 drops off at about 4500 -5000 rpm. Right around that RPM range the motor seems to harmonize and run smoother as well.

This is true for any motor..Even though the HP keeps increasing with more PRM, the torque falls off at a certain point thus causing the car to feel as if its not accelerating as hard.

The problem is that he says it feels fine in 2nd but not in 1st. The engine should be making the same power and torque at WOT at 5000 RPM regardless of the gear, unless there is some sort of control mechanism kicking in.
